What is a Mental Health Assessment? A mental health assessment is an organized procedure focused on understanding an individual's mental wellbeing, determining symptoms, and diagnosing mental health conditions. It is typically carried out by mental health specialists-- consisting of psychologists, psychiatrists, social employees, and therapists-- and involves gathering extensive info about the individual's psychological, psychological, and social performance.
Importance of Mental Health Assessment The significance of mental health assessments can not be overstated. They serve numerous purposes, consisting of:
Diagnosis: Proper identification of mental health disorders based on established requirements. Treatment Planning: Assisting in developing a reliable treatment strategy tailored to the individual's needs. Understanding Functioning: Assessing how mental health issues affect everyday performance, relationships, and overall quality of life. Keeping track of Progress: Evaluating modifications in time to fine-tune treatment methods. Resource Allocation: Guiding individuals toward appropriate resources and assistance systems. Kinds Of Mental Health Assessments Mental health assessments can be broadly categorized into numerous types, depending on the needs of the specific and the context in which the assessment is being carried out. Below is a table summing up the common types:
Type of Assessment Description Medical Interviews Structured or unstructured discussions in between the customer and the clinician. Self-Report Questionnaires Standardized questionnaires finished by the specific to gather information on symptoms and experiences. Behavioral Assessments Observations of an individual's behavior in particular settings to identify patterns or concerns. Mental Testing Analysis of cognitive functions, personality, and emotional states through standardized screening tools. Practical Assessments Examining a person's capability to carry out everyday activities and tasks, considering their mental health obstacles. The Mental Health Assessment Process The mental health assessment procedure normally involves a number of essential steps:
Pre-Assessment: This preliminary phase might include completing surveys or supplying background information before the scheduled conference. Scientific Interview: A mental health professional conducts a detailed interview to comprehend the individual's history, providing concerns, and general performance. Standardized Testing: Appropriate mental tests may be administered to evaluate specific locations of mental health, such as state of mind, stress and anxiety, or cognitive function. Data Analysis: The expert compiles and evaluates information from interviews and tests to comprehend the individual's mental health status. Feedback Session: The clinician provides feedback to the specific regarding their assessment results, possible medical diagnoses, and recommendations for treatment. Follow-Up: Regular follow-up assessments may be arranged to monitor progress and change treatment plans as required. Elements Influencing Mental Health Assessments A number of factors can affect the results of mental health assessments, consisting of:
Cultural Background: Cultural distinctions can impact communication styles, sign expression, and understanding of mental health. Individual History: A person's background-- such as injury, household history, and previous treatment experiences-- can impact their mental health. Existing Life Stressors: Ongoing life challenges or changes, such as job loss, divorce, or bereavement, can affect mental health and assessment results. Possible Outcomes of a Mental Health Assessment The outcomes of a mental health assessment need to provide insights into different elements of an individual's mental state. Possible results include:

How long does a mental health assessment take? The period of a mental health assessment can vary commonly, generally varying from one hour to a number of hours, depending upon the intricacy of the case and the methods utilized.
2. Are mental health assessments personal? Yes, mental health assessments are typically confidential, with exceptions pertaining to safety issues, such as imminent damage to oneself or others.
